Oil Filled Radiators
Oil filled radiators are popular domestic heaters as they are silent and tend not to promote dust. They are sealed units that contain oil. The oil is heated, which then releases the heat over a period of time. Once the temperature is ... continue reading "Guide to Portable Electric Heaters"
